JQuery JcMarquee.js 是一个基于 jQuery 的插件,它允许开发者轻松地在网页上实现专业的滚动效果。无论是用于展示新闻动态、公告信息还是产品推荐,JcMarquee.js 都能提供灵活且强大的功能。本文将深入探讨 JcMarquee.js 的使用方法、特点以及如何通过它打造出令人印象深刻的滚动效果。
一、JcMarquee.js 简介
JcMarquee.js 是一个轻量级的 jQuery 插件,它通过简单的 HTML 和 CSS 代码,结合 jQuery 的事件处理,能够实现多种滚动效果。这个插件不仅易于使用,而且兼容性好,适用于各种现代浏览器。
二、JcMarquee.js 的安装与使用
1. 安装
首先,确保你的项目中已经包含了 jQuery 库。然后,可以通过以下步骤安装 JcMarquee.js:
<script src="https://cdn.jsdelivr.net/npm/jcmarquee@1.3.2/dist/jcMarquee.min.js"></script>
2. 使用
在 HTML 中,你可以这样使用 JcMarquee.js:
<div class="marquee">
<div class="marquee-content">
这里是滚动内容,这里是滚动内容,这里是滚动内容,这里是滚动内容...
</div>
</div>
然后,在 jQuery 的代码中添加以下脚本:
$(document).ready(function(){
$('.marquee').jcMarquee({
'speed': 40,
'drift': 2,
'display': 1,
'control': 'prev Next',
'onHoverStop': true
});
});
这里,speed
是滚动速度,drift
是滚动时内容移动的距离,display
是显示内容的数量,control
是控制按钮,onHoverStop
是鼠标悬停时是否停止滚动。
三、JcMarquee.js 的特点
- 响应式设计:JcMarquee.js 能够自动适应不同屏幕尺寸,确保滚动效果在不同设备上都能正常显示。
- 丰富的配置选项:通过修改配置参数,可以轻松实现各种滚动效果,如左右滚动、上下滚动等。
- 兼容性强:支持主流浏览器,包括 Chrome、Firefox、Safari 和 Edge。
- 易于集成:与 jQuery 的集成简单,只需引入 JcMarquee.js 和 jQuery 库即可使用。
四、案例展示
以下是一个使用 JcMarquee.js 实现的左右滚动效果的案例:
<div class="marquee horizontal">
<div class="marquee-content">
<div>新闻1:今天天气晴朗,适合户外活动。</div>
<div>新闻2:明日有雨,请注意出行安全。</div>
<div>新闻3:本周气温逐渐升高,注意防晒。</div>
</div>
</div>
$(document).ready(function(){
$('.marquee.horizontal').jcMarquee({
'speed': 40,
'drift': 2,
'display': 1,
'control': 'prev Next',
'onHoverStop': true,
'direction': 'left'
});
});
在这个案例中,通过设置 direction
为 'left'
,实现了左右滚动效果。
五、总结
JQuery JcMarquee.js 是一个功能强大且易于使用的插件,能够帮助开发者轻松实现各种滚动效果。通过本文的介绍,相信你已经对 JcMarquee.js 有了一定的了解。在未来的项目中,不妨尝试使用它,为你的网页增添更多活力。